Biography

Richard M. Wilner is a founding member of Wilner & O'Reilly, APLC, and is Board Certified by the State Bar of California as a Specialist in Immigration and Nationality Law. He is admitted to practice law in the State of California and before the U.S. District Courts for the Central, Northern and Southern Districts of California, the Northern District of Texas, the U.S. Court of Appeals for the Ninth Circuit and the U.S. Supreme Court. Mr. Wilner has received the coveted Martindale-Hubbell AV Rating, the highest legal and ethical rating that one can receive from one's peers in the legal community. Similarly, he has been awarded the title of Super Lawyer from 2007 to the present.

He is the Vice-Chair of the Orange County Bar Association's Immigration Law Section, the acting Military Assistance Program liaison between the Southern California Chapter of the American Immigration Lawyers Association and the Department of Homeland Security. He serves on the Board of Directors for the Orange County Jewish Bar Association and previously served as a Commissioner on the State Bar of California's Immigration and Nationality Law Advisory Commission (INLAC).

Actively committed to pro bono service, Richard volunteers his time assisting the residents of Human Options, a shelter for abused women and children in Orange County, with their immigration needs.

Mr. Wilner is best known for his providing expert immigration law advise to entrepreneurs and business persons within the small to middle market sector. Likewise, he is highly regarded for his work on behalf of foreign nationals of extraordinary ability in athletics, arts/entertainment, science and business.

A native of Los Angeles, California, Mr. Wilner received his law degree (Juris Doctor) as well as a Master of Laws (LL.M.) in Transnational Business Practice from McGeorge School of Law, University of the Pacific and the University of Salzburg, Austria. He also received a Certificate in International Law from the National University of Singapore and Bachelors of Arts degrees in Philosophy and Religious Studies from the University of California in 1992. He has also worked in Thailand and Vietnam.

Mr. Wilner is married and the proud father of two boys. When not working, his time is spent with family, fishing and practicing Wrestling and Muay Thai.
